Exporting Essentials: Key Steps for New Suppliers

For new suppliers venturing into the export market, the journey can be both exciting and challenging. Understanding the essential steps for successful exporting is crucial in navigating this complex landscape.

Research Your Target Markets

The first step for any new supplier is to conduct thorough market research. Identify potential countries or regions where your products may have demand, and understand the local regulations and consumer preferences.

Develop a Competitive Product Offering

To stand out in the global market, suppliers must develop products that meet international standards. Consider factors such as quality, pricing, and unique features that appeal to your target audience.

Establish Logistics and Distribution Channels

Efficient logistics are vital for successful exporting. Collaborate with freight forwarders and logistics providers to develop a reliable distribution plan that ensures timely delivery of goods to international buyers.

Understand Export Regulations

Familiarize yourself with export regulations in both your country and the destination market. Compliance with customs regulations is essential to avoid delays and penalties.

Build Strong Relationships with Buyers

Networking plays a significant role in exporting. Attend trade shows and industry events to connect with potential buyers. Strong relationships can lead to repeat business and recommendations.
